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Ashurst (Kent) to Dunblane start from as little as £58.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Ashurst (Kent) to Dunblane start from £102.10 one way

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Ashurst (Kent) to Dunblane are available for £210.30 one way

Station Facilities and Accessibility

Ashurst (Kent) station operates without a traditional ticket office, but fear not—ticket machines are available, allowing you to collect pre-purchased tickets or buy on the spot. These machines cater to Disabled Persons Railcard holders, ensuring accessibility for all passengers. The station itself features step-free access to platform 2, though accessing platform 1 does require navigating some steps via a footbridge. Those requiring assistance can find help points on both platforms, making it easier for everyone to navigate their journey.

While staff assistance isn't available, passengers can withdraw support directly from the on-train crew, assuring that help is always at hand. For those driving, the station offers 65 parking spaces, with two dedicated to accessible parking. Cyclists can take advantage of the bike stands located within the car park, though it's worthwhile noting that these spaces are unsheltered.

Station Amenities and Services

When you arrive at Dunblane Station, you will find a variety of facilities designed for ease and accessibility. Tickets can be purchased from the office or convenient machines, which also support online ticket collections. For those needing assistance, staff are available during weekday mornings and early afternoons. Importantly, the station boasts step-free access across all platforms, making it highly accessible for passengers with mobility needs. Although there are no on-site shops or dining facilities, the station ensures basic comforts with available waiting areas and seating.

Connection and Accessibility

Reaching other transport modes from Dunblane is straightforward. The station offers connections to numerous bus services including a Rail Replacement Service, with detailed information available at this location. Taxi services are also readily accessible, ensuring that onward travel is well catered to. For those cycling to the station, there are 13 bicycle storage spaces with security measures in place.
